If Islamic ethical thought reveals the relationship between God and man, we must observe what kind of being is God and what kind of being is man. Therefore, in order to continue the research, I divide ethics into `Godism`, `theory of human` and `the revelation and reasoning that deals with the relationship of both`. As a first attempt in a previous essay, I observed the `theory of human` viewed from Islamic ethics, in this essay, which follows the previous, I am going to discuss the Godism viewed from the Islamic ethics. But because Godism has a vast content, I am going to divide this research into two volumes. In this essay I am going to discuss Islamic ethics centered on the uniqueness of God(the fact that God is one), and the next essay is going to deal with ethics, but this time centered on the justice of God and the will of God. Just like I discussed the `theory of human`, in the same way I am going to research through comparing the controversial points and differences of traditional theology and rationalistic ethical thought.
